Why did Dumbledore and Grindelwald break up?

Believing they were working towards the greater good, Dumbledore and Grindelwald parted ways following the death of Albus' sister Ariana who was caught in the crossfire of a duel between Dumbledore, Grindelwald, and Albus' brother Aberforth.

Why can t Albus fight Grindelwald?

Dumbledore and Grindelwald took a blood oath to not fight each other. "Fantastic Beasts: The Crimes of Grindelwald," the second film in the series, reveals that as teenagers Dumbledore and Grindelwald undertook a blood pact that wouldn't allow them to move against each other.

Is Credence Dumbledore's Brother?

It turns out that Credence isn't Albus' brother — he's his nephew. "The Secrets of Dumbledore" circumvents the timeline issues by revealing that Credence — or rather, Aurelius — isn't Albus' brother. He's Aberforth's son, which makes him Albus' nephew.

Who is Dumbledores secret brother?

Aberforth Dumbledore

Aberforth is the younger brother of Albus Dumbledore and owner of The Hog's Head Inn in Hogsmeade. He clearly has quite a lot of resentment towards his brother, as well as Grindelwald, which is mainly due to the death of his and Albus' little sister, Ariana.

What was Albus curse?

The curse on the ring refers to a deadly curse placed by Voldemort on Marvolo Gaunt's ring to protect the Horcrux within. The curse was lethal and would have killed Dumbledore almost immediately after he put the ring on if Snape hadn't performed a counter-curse to slow it's spread.

How is Newt Scamander related to Luna Lovegood?

He's Luna Lovegood's grandfather-in-law

Luna Lovegood ends up marrying Rolf Scamander, who is Newt's grandson. If grandson is anything like his grandfather — which is quite likely, as both are magizoologists — that means we can expect Newt to be a bit of an eccentric.
